I've installed GP 9 on Windows Server 2012 Standard x64. When I start Dynamics GP, the "Welcome to Microsoft Dynamics GP" window shows, the server dropdown is populated and the server I want is selected but the application is unresponsive for 5-10 seconds so I can't enter a User ID. Once it becomes responsive, it seems to work fine and I can log in.

BTW, I have another Dynamics GP instance running on Server 2003 R2 and it starts fine.

Any idea why the hang at startup and how I can get rid of it?

    GP 9 on W2012 Server is not supported. Did you use the 32 bit ODBC driver for the DSN. What version of SQL are you using?

    Yes using the 32 bit ODBC driver. MSSQL 2000 on another server (Windows Server 2003 R2).

    What kind of anti-virus software is on the server? Can you try creating a new DSN and use an older SQL Native client?

    Third party add-ons? When the splash screen pops up, GP is loading up the installed modules. It also loads up any customization .dlls in the add-ons folder. More add-ons can also mean slower start up.

    Using Webroot SecureAnywhere. I've tried it disabled with the same results. Where do I get an older SQL Native client to try?

    No, there is only one native SQL Client shown when adding a new DSN and that is version 6.02.9200.16384. Should I download and try an earlier client?

    I tried the SQL 2005 client with the same results.

    Try setting up your DSN using the IP address of the server instead of the server name.
